How the Demographics Are Shaping the Housing Market


I’ve been writing about how demographics are future within the housing marketplace for practically a decade (see right here, right here and right here).

This has primarily been from the attitude of millennials as a result of that’s my demographic.

Following the Nice Monetary Disaster, many pundits assumed millennials would by no means quiet down, personal a house or purchase a automobile. They’d merely reside in a giant metropolis and eschew the standard path to the suburbs.

This by no means made sense to me.

I noticed so a lot of my friends transfer to a giant metropolis after school after which purchase a house within the burbs as soon as they received married or began a household. Millennials simply put this off for longer than different generations due to the GFC and the truth that a whole lot of this group went to highschool longer.

Millennials (and Gen Z and Gen X) are mainly proper on monitor with the newborn boomers on the subject of homeownership on the similar stage in life (through Redfin):

That is simply what occurs while you attain a sure age.

I do know housing affordability shouldn’t be nice proper now however I’ve a sense many younger folks will determine it out within the years forward. I might be stunned if the millennial and Gen Z traces don’t carefully monitor the boomer and Gen X traces that got here earlier than them. That’s simply what we do on this nation.

However sufficient concerning the younger folks.

The older generations nonetheless management nearly 90% of the housing inventory on this nation:

Sure, Gen X, you’re thought of previous now too. Apparently, Gen X owns round one-third of the housing on this nation, which is the place the newborn boomers had been in 1989.

The distinction between now and former iterations is we’ve by no means had a demographic of 70+ million folks reside so long as child boomers are going to reside with this a lot wealth in play.

Child boomers had been born between 1946 and 1964. Which means the oldest cohort of boomers is approaching age 78. In the event that they’ve lived that lengthy the typical life expectancy is 88 for males and 90 for females. The youngest boomers are approaching age 60. Common life expectancy from age 60 is 83 and 86, respectively.1

So we’re most likely speaking no less than one other 20 years or so of child boomer dominance till Gen X takes the throne. There are going to be some fascinating adjustments to the housing market in that point.

Simply take a look at the share of homes which might be free and away from a mortgage (through Bloomberg):

Bloomberg notes:

The variety of mortgage-free, single-family houses and condos elevated by 7.9 million from 2012 to 2022, to 33.3 million, in line with Census Bureau information analyzed by Bloomberg.

As child boomers age, they’re snapping up–or holding on to–a bigger share of houses general. Of the 84.6 million owner-occupied houses that existed in 2022, nearly 33% had been owned by folks age 65 or older, a 4.6-percentage-point enhance from 10 years earlier.

Virtually two-thirds of all mortgage-free houses within the US are paid off over a interval of greater than 21 years, in line with information compiled by Attom, an actual property property information supplier.

Proudly owning a house with no mortgage offers this group tons of flexibility.

No month-to-month mortgage cost is good however they will additionally use their fairness for negotiating functions. The affordability equation adjustments significantly when you’ll be able to downsize to a brand new place and pay with money from the sale of your paid-off house.

Within the present unhealthy housing market, older persons are in a a lot better place than most younger folks and so they’re taking benefit.

The Washington Submit confirmed the median age of a repeat homebuyer is now near 60, up from 36 in 1981.

In the meantime, the typical age of first-time homebuyers has elevated from 29 in 1981 to 35 now. And whereas there are nonetheless first-time homebuyers out there, that group is declining.

In line with the Nationwide Affiliation of Realtors, the typical share of purchases from first-time homebuyers because the early-Nineteen Eighties is 38%. First-time consumers solely make up 32% right this moment.

The NAR says the standard house vendor final yr was 60 years previous.

Seventy % of consumers haven’t any kids below the age of 18 residing with them. That’s an all-time report excessive. The quantity was 42% in 1985.

Family earnings for the typical purchaser was $107,000, up from $88,000 within the earlier yr.

That is clearly a horrible atmosphere for first-time homebuyers. They’re competing with a gaggle of people that have built-in fairness, greater incomes and extra flexibility. Plus the mortgage lock-in impact has depleted the availability of homes on the market in the marketplace.

The provision scenario will enhance finally. Individuals will get married, divorced, have children, die off, change jobs, transfer to new cities, and so on. Life goes on.

The passage of time is undefeated so finally this dynamic will flip. The hope with the newborn boomer housing inventory is finally they may downsize, move their house right down to the following technology or promote to finance their life-style in retirement.

I don’t imagine that tens of millions of retiring child boomers will crash the inventory market in retirement. That argument by no means made sense to me because the high 10% owns practically 90% of the shares on this nation.

However the housing market is totally different than the inventory market. Housing is by far the largest monetary asset for the center class. Most individuals have extra money of their home than their 401k.

That is most likely a 2030s story however I don’t know the way that is going to play out.

Perhaps there can be a wave of retirees promoting their houses. Or perhaps they’ll take out HELOCs and reverse mortgages to spend down these accrued pressured financial savings. Or perhaps their kids will inherit their houses and reside in them if they will’t afford one on their very own.

There isn’t a historic precedent right here.

Nevertheless, millennials will rule the housing market sooner or later. It’s only a numbers recreation.

However for now the older generations are within the driver’s seat on the subject of the housing market.
